THREE leaky windows have been fixed at a scout hut following a £2,000 grant.

Whiteleaf Scout Group received a donation of £2000 from the Buckinghamshire Community Foundation (BCF) to replace leaking wooden roof windows at the Speen HQ.

Peter Keen, a trustee of the foundation, presented a cheque to the group at an event at Speen Woods. It has been funded from the Richard Houchin Fund at the Foundation.

BCF is an independent charity which is dedicated to promoting giving in the area.

Since January 2000 they have given more than £3million in grants in more than 1,500 community groups and projects.
